Once again, Signs First is honored to have the opportunity to provide signage for the National Civil Rights Museum’s Freedom Award. The Freedom Award, the Museum's signature event, pays tribute to individuals who have shown unwavering commitment to promoting justice and equality. This year’s honorees were civil and human rights activist and broadcasting executive Xernona Clayton; Sherrilyn Ifill, the president and director-counsel emeritus of the NAACP; and Academy Award-winning filmmaker Spike Lee. Signs First produced several step and repeat background banners, retractable banners, and other items for this prestigious event. Congratulations to the award recipients, and to the Museum for a fantastic event.

BEFORE AND AFTER. Signs First is honored to help the National Civil Rights Museum update their interpretive signage at the historic Lorraine Motel, site of the Rev.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r.’s 1968 assassination. The signs, located in the courtyard and below the balcony where Dr. King fell, help tell the story of this tragic and world-changing event. Dr. King’s legacy and mission continue with the annual Freedom Award, set for Oct. 17, 2024.

Saluting one of our great customers, Rust College. An historically black college in Holly Springs, Mississippi, it was founded in 1866 and is the second-oldest private college in the state. Affiliated with the United Methodist Church, it is one of ten historically black colleges and universities founded before 1868 that are still operating. We have been honored to provide Rust College with a wide variety of signage over the years. Rust College and Signs First – working together to educate tomorrow’s leaders.
